Отправляет email-рассылки с помощью сервиса Sendsay
  Все выпуски  

RFpro.ru: Установка и настройка Unix/Linux/FreeBSD


Хостинг портала RFpro.ru:
Московский хостер
Профессиональный ХОСТИНГ на базе Linux x64 и Windows x64

РАССЫЛКИ ПОРТАЛА RFPRO.RU

Лучшие эксперты по данной тематике

Valery N
Статус: Мастер-Эксперт
Рейтинг: 4386
∙ повысить рейтинг »
Хватов Сергей
Статус: Академик
Рейтинг: 608
∙ повысить рейтинг »
Чичерин Вадим Викторович
Статус: Профессионал
Рейтинг: 356
∙ повысить рейтинг »

/ КОМПЬЮТЕРЫ И СОФТ / Установка и настройка ОС / Unix/Linux/FreeBSD

Номер выпуска:1346
Дата выхода:02.02.2014, 14:43
Администратор рассылки:Калашников О.А. (Руководитель)
Подписчиков / экспертов:107 / 24
Вопросов / ответов:3 / 10

Консультация # 84532: Здравствуйте. 1. Проблема с ядром 2.6.х. Скомпилил успешно, поставил, но при его загрузке пишет: 2. УЖАСНО!!! медленная компиляция. На работе компик постарее чем дома, но тот же wine ставится за 20 минут, а дома 4 часа. Почему так? Скажите пожалуйста. .


Консультация # 97635: Поставил Mandriva. Установил в качестве пакетов и LILO и GRUB. Но, в качестве загрузчика указал GRUB. Проблема в том, что грузится все равно с LILO. И естественно выдает ошибку Init, т.к. установщик настроил GRUB. Что делать?...
Консультация # 69041: Доброе время суток эксперты! Возник вопросик. Есть идея сделать свой небольшой серверок для LAN на базе ARM процессора. Скажите пожалуйста, каким образом компилируется такая ОС ? Т.е. как заливается прошивка, сколько нужно места и что нужно компилить. Мне нужно на нем NAT, DHCP, PPPOE, DNS, SSH... ..

Консультация # 84532:

Здравствуйте.
1. Проблема с ядром 2.6.х. Скомпилил успешно, поставил, но при его загрузке пишет:
2. УЖАСНО!!! медленная компиляция. На работе компик постарее чем дома, но тот же wine ставится за 20 минут, а дома 4 часа. Почему так? Скажите пожалуйста.

Дата отправки: 28.04.2007, 06:45
Вопрос задал: Forster
Всего ответов: 3
Страница онлайн-консультации »


Консультирует Kvazar:

Здравствуйте, Forster!
В какой последовательности собиралось ядро?
cd /usr/src/linux (предполагается что тут исходники лежат)
make menuconfig
make
make modules
make modules_install
make install
после этого останется прописать в /boot/grub/menu.lst (это случай с SuSE, но в других аналогично)
секцию (если после make install не скажет система что сама все сделала):
title 2.6.16.13-4-new_kernel
root (hd0,0)
kernel /boot/vmlinuz-2.6.16.13-4-new_kernel root=/dev/hda1 vga=0x31a resume=/dev/sda1 splash=silent showopts
initrd /boot/initrd-2.6.16.13-4-new_kernel
- должно нормально загрузиться, если ни чего лишнего не отключил

Консультировал: Kvazar
Дата отправки: 28.04.2007, 07:09
Рейтинг ответа:

НЕ одобряю 0 одобряю!


Консультирует PVS:

Здравствуйте, Forster!
1)"error mounting ext3" - копайте в этом направлении. Либо что-то не так с поддержкой ext3, либо с поддержкой харда. При make modules_install могли быть сообщения о неудовлетворённых зависимостях - проверьте может там что-то.
2)факторов много. Вы могли настроить разный набор служб, может быть у Вас дома меньше оперативки или медленный хард (насчёт харда - проверьте включился ли он в режим DMA).

Консультировал: PVS
Дата отправки: 28.04.2007, 10:16
Рейтинг ответа:

НЕ одобряю 0 одобряю!


Консультирует Мирошник Александр:

Здравствуйте, Forster!

1) Включите поддержку EXT2; После компиляции сделайте mkinitrd (пример использования этой программы - mkinitrd -h)

2)
а) Создали ли Вы своп.
б) Не рациональное использование ресурсов за счет неправильной сборки ядра.

Консультировал: Мирошник Александр
Дата отправки: 28.04.2007, 10:23
Рейтинг ответа:

НЕ одобряю 0 одобряю!

Консультация # 97635:

Поставил Mandriva. Установил в качестве пакетов и LILO и GRUB. Но, в качестве загрузчика указал GRUB. Проблема в том, что грузится все равно с LILO. И естественно выдает ошибку Init, т.к. установщик настроил GRUB. Что делать?

Дата отправки: 07.08.2007, 17:03
Вопрос задал: Narsereg
Всего ответов: 5
Страница онлайн-консультации »


Консультирует Volodimir :

Здравствуйте, Narsereg!
как вариант Запустится с компакта выбрать обновление, пропустить несколько шагов и переустановить grub.
в процесе установки инсталятора не спеши, покопайся в настройках посмотри чтобы все устанавливалось куда надо.

Консультировал: Volodimir
Дата отправки: 07.08.2007, 17:11
Рейтинг ответа:

НЕ одобряю 0 одобряю!


Консультирует Fractaler:

Здравствуйте, Narsereg!
Обычно в таких случаях я делаю так:
Загружаюсь с диска, подключаю раздел с системой, например,
mount /dev/hda1 /mnt
меняю корневой каталог:
chroot /mnt
и восстанавливаю загрузчик. Судя по Вашему описанию, GRUB не установился. Поэтому надо сделать
grub-install hd0
если загрузчик устанавливается на первый диск (физический) или
grub-install hd1
если загрузчик устанавливается на второй диск.
Если есть необходимость в настройке загрузчика, можно воспользоваться любым имеющимся в системе консольным редактором.
Если какой-либо важный каталог находится на отдельном разделе, то его нужно подключить. Скажем, если /boot находится на hda2, то после chroot надо будет сделать
mount /dev/hda2 /boot
А если отдельно вынесен /usr (например, hda3), то его обязательно подключать до chroot, иначе Вы останетесь без большинства программ.
mount /dev/hda3 /mnt/usr

Удачи!

Консультировал: Fractaler
Дата отправки: 07.08.2007, 19:07
Рейтинг ответа:

НЕ одобряю 0 одобряю!


Консультирует GMA:

Здравствуйте, Narsereg!
Если grub утановлен, то можно просто попробовать выполнить в терминале команду grub
Удачи!

Консультировал: GMA
Дата отправки: 07.08.2007, 19:21
Рейтинг ответа:

НЕ одобряю 0 одобряю!


Консультирует Мирошник Александр:

Здравствуйте, Narsereg!

Куда вы ставили загрузчик? В MBR? Если да - то попробуйте зайти в single user mode (параметр -s или init=1 при старте LILO) и набрать комманду grub или /sbin/grub (поищите где он у Вас лежит) - тогда в МБР вместо ЛИЛО пропишется ГРУБ

Консультировал: Мирошник Александр
Дата отправки: 08.08.2007, 12:57
Рейтинг ответа:

НЕ одобряю 0 одобряю!


Консультирует ROSSOU john:

Здравствуйте, Narsereg!

Skaju tupo, no zato pomojet

PEREUSTANOVI

Консультировал: ROSSOU john
Дата отправки: 09.08.2007, 14:03
Рейтинг ответа:

НЕ одобряю 0 одобряю!

Консультация # 69041:

Доброе время суток эксперты!
Возник вопросик. Есть идея сделать свой небольшой серверок для LAN на базе ARM процессора.
Скажите пожалуйста, каким образом компилируется такая ОС ?
Т.е. как заливается прошивка, сколько нужно места и что нужно компилить. Мне нужно на нем NAT, DHCP, PPPOE, DNS, SSH...

Дата отправки: 29.12.2006, 14:32
Вопрос задал: Delphin
Всего ответов: 2
Страница онлайн-консультации »


Консультирует Хватов Сергей (Академик):

Здравствуйте, Delphin!

ARM должен быть 9 серии, например AT91RM9200. Места достаточно 8Mb flash (даже 4) и 16 MB ram

Собирать надо toolchain (кросс-компилятор), glibc, ядро, две стадии загрузчика (primary и u-boot), после чего всё что вам надо. На всех этих этапах густо разложены многочисленные грабли, так что этот процесс будет долгим.

А ещё я заметил, что плату вы собираетесь разработать самостоятельно, так что вам придётся одновременно отладивать железо и софт. По-моему - это весьма рискованое предприятие.

Консультировал: Хватов Сергей (Академик)
Дата отправки: 29.12.2006, 15:08
Рейтинг ответа:

НЕ одобряю 0 одобряю!


Консультирует PVS:

Здравствуйте, Delphin!
К предыдущему ответу хочу добавить "свои 5 копеек":
1) 2.4-е ядро умело само себя загружать (для i386, для ARM не уверен, но если да, то у Вас отпадает необходимость в загрузчике)
2) uClibc ("заменитель" glibc) имеет замечательный интерфейс для кросс-компилирования себя под все поддерживаемые платформы + там же можно выбрать дополнительные программы
3) большинство Ваших запросов покрывает busybox, если его (и все, что еще надо будет кроме него) скомпилировть как статические файлы, то и сам uClibc на результирующей машине не нужен

Консультировал: PVS
Дата отправки: 29.12.2006, 15:38
Рейтинг ответа:

НЕ одобряю 0 одобряю!


Оценить выпуск | Задать вопрос экспертам

главная страница  |  стать участником  |  получить консультацию
техническая поддержка  |  восстановить логин/пароль

Дорогой читатель!
Команда портала RFPRO.RU благодарит Вас за то, что Вы пользуетесь нашими услугами. Вы только что прочли очередной выпуск рассылки. Мы старались. Пожалуйста, оцените его. Если совет помог Вам, если Вам понравился ответ, Вы можете поблагодарить автора - для этого в каждом ответе есть специальные ссылки. Вы можете оставить отзыв о работе портале. Нам очень важно знать Ваше мнение. Вы можете поближе познакомиться с жизнью портала, посетив наш форум, почитав журнал, который издают наши эксперты. Если у Вас есть желание помочь людям, поделиться своими знаниями, Вы можете зарегистрироваться экспертом. Заходите - у нас интересно!
МЫ РАБОТАЕМ ДЛЯ ВАС!



В избранное